About The Position

As an Occupational Therapist (OTR), you will help to ensure that REHAB patients and their families receive caring and dedicated service at REHAB. You will provide support for the Therapy Department and assist with a variety of services with a commitment to delivering high-quality, comprehensive and innovative inpatient and outpatient rehabilitation services. These services include interpreting physician’s orders, performing evaluations and assessments; designing and implementing plans of care; maintaining treatment and progress reports; drafting and/or presenting oral or written reports of patient’s status; collaborating with team members toward reaching patient’s goals.

Requirements

  • Current State of Hawaii OT licensure.
  • Current NBCOT certification as an OTR.
  • Current BLS certification
  • Completion of competencies and other job-related and REHAB requirements.
  • Graduate from an ACOTE accredited school of Occupational Therapy.
  • Ability to safely and effectively manage patients’ mobility.
  • Ability to clearly communicate effectively, verbally and in writing.
  • Ability to safely provide care to patients.
